Red River Communications is seeking a Chief Financial Officer to join our senior leadership team.


This is a working manager role overseeing a small payroll and accounting team. The ideal candidate brings both strategic insights and practical accounting expertise to help Red River Communications (RRC) maintain strong financial health while supporting our organizational mission.

What You’ll Do:
  • Lead the preparation of timely and accurate financial statements in accordance with GAAP
  • Assist the benefits administrator with annual enrollment
  • Serve as a strategic advisor to the CEO and Board of Directors
  • Develop and maintain accounting policies and procedures and internal controls
  • Present financial data and analysis to the Board
  • Lead the development of the annual budget and forecasts
  • Prepare financial models and analysis to support capital investments, pricing, contract negotiations and strategic initiatives
  • Monitor company cash flow and liquidity needs
  • Analyze long-term debt obligations and make recommendations on financing
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able local, state and federal financial regulations
  • Prepare and submit financial data and reports to regulatory bodies
  • Coordinate and support annual audits
  • Lead investment portfolio strategy, make recommendations to board
  • Lead Payroll Processing
Why This Role Matters:

This is a crucial role in helping communities gain access to faster internet. Your work will directly impact our ability to expand our network.

What You Bring:
  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ance or a related field
  • 8 years of progressively responsible accounting/finance experience
  • 3 years of supervisory experience
  • Telecommunications or cooperative experience preferred
  • CPA or MBA preferred

Red River Communications is a community-focused telecommunications cooperative that provides reliable broadband services to our local area. We provide fiber-optic broadband, Wi-Fi, digital TV, landline phones, hosted business systems, security cameras, and cellular services in North Dakota and Minnesota. Established in 1951 and based in Abercrombie, ND, we recently expanded to include the communities of Breckenridge, Wahpeton, rural Wahpeton, Wilkin County and Clay County, Minnesota. We strive to deliver high-speed internet access to enhance connectivity, economic development, and quality of life for all our members.
